Iris
Starring
Judi Dench, Kate Winslet,
Jim Broadbent, Hugh Bonnville, Samuel West, Pauline
McLynn and Penelope Wilton.
Written by Sir Richard
Eyre and Charles Wood
Produced by Robert Fox
and Scott Rudin
Directed by Sir Richard
Eyre
Released
by Miramax
ETA: Plot: This film
covers writer Iris Murdoch's and John Bayley's first encounter
more than 40 years ago while teaching together at Oxford,
their marriage together and the writer's subsequent struggle
with Alzheimer's disease. (Amiring

Page created. This biopic of writer Iris Murdoch see's Kate
Winslet and Judi Dench playing the title role. Winslet will
play Murdoch in her younger days while Judi Dench will play
the writer in her later years.
Iris is being co-produced by the BBC. The Beeb are trying
to make bigger budget movie to lure British talent back
from Hollywood. Iris is the first of these co-productions
between the BBC and Hollywood production company Cobalt
Media. 'Marla' found this article;
'BBC head of film, David Thompson, has drawn up a wish list
of directors including Ridley Scott (Gladiator), John Madden
(Shakespeare in Love) and Jon Amiel (Entrapment). Other
Hollywood-based British directors will also be approached
by Mr Thompson. Nearly all the Brits now used by the big
Hollywood studios started their careers with the BBC. The
move was made possible by an extraordinary deal engineered
by the senior BBC executive, Alan Yentob, with the Beverly
Hills production company Cobalt Media. The American company
is putting about pounds 90m into the partnership and BBC
Films about pounds 3m. Yet the BBC will retain 50 per cent
of the profits because it will supply the expertise. This
not only means the BBC can make big- budget films, it also
means the corporation can make big money... The BBC has
already tried to get American co-producers for its latest
slate of films. Iris, the forthcoming film about Iris Murdoch
starring Dame Judi Dench, and Kate Winslet as Ms Murdoch
when she was young, has an American co-producer.'
